// DRIFT_CORRECTION_PPM: compensation factor for the Thornvale
// greenhouse humidity probes. The Model-K sensors drift upward
// roughly 0.3% per week in high-condensation zones, so we apply
// this correction at read time rather than recalibrating hardware.
// Do not change this without rerunning the four-week drift study;
// past guesses overcorrected and triggered false misting cycles.
// The firmware build the study was run against is recorded below.

session token of yajof-bagef = htk4_937d

Subject: CSV Import Wizard — sandbox access for your plugin

Hi team,

As discussed, the Fieldbind CSV Import Wizard now exposes plugin hooks for column mapping and validation. Your plugin can register handlers via the `/wizard/hooks` endpoint on our partner sandbox. All hook registrations require a bearer token scoped to your partner tenant; it covers both the mapping and validation APIs. Tokens are valid for thirty days, after which we'll rotate and resend. Please confirm receipt once your first test import succeeds. Your sandbox token is:

session JWT of yawep-yawep = eyJhbGciOiJIUzI1NiIsInR5cCI6IkpXVCJ9.eyJzdWIiOiI3pWF3_In0.aXYsHiog

### Escalation

If FareLogic returns inconsistent shipping-fee calculations after a rules deploy, first roll back the ruleset via `farelogic rules revert`. Do not edit rules in place during an incident. If the revert fails or fee totals remain wrong after two evaluation cycles, escalate to the Pricing Platform rotation. Their on-call inbox is monitored around the clock and listed below.

escalation mailbox, hadug-bajog: sormir@norvalabs.internal